| ÖÇ1 | 1)The student evaluates the patient's general medical condition and plans appropriate endodontic treatment. |
| ÖÇ2 | 2) Understand the importance of microbial pathogenicity and infection control in endodontics. |
| ÖÇ3 | 3) Lists the principles of cleaning and shaping root canals |
| ÖÇ4 | 4) Understands the principles of filling root canals |
| ÖÇ5 | 5) Defines pain requiring endodontic treatment and emergency endodontic treatments. |
| ÖÇ6 | 6) Evaluates success and failure in endodontic treatment and understands re-treatment of root canal treatments. |
| ÖÇ7 | 7) Lists the bleaching methods for endodontically treated teeth |
| ÖÇ8 | 8) By acquiring basic endodontic preclinical/practical knowledge, the student becomes able to apply endodontic practices on extracted teeth. |
